About 2-amino-N-[[(5S)-3-[3-fluoro-4-[4-(2-methoxyacetyl)piperazin-1-yl]phenyl]-2-oxo-1,3-oxazolidin-5-yl]methyl]acetamide

2-amino-N-[[(5S)-3-[3-fluoro-4-[4-(2-methoxyacetyl)piperazin-1-yl]phenyl]-2-oxo-1,3-oxazolidin-5-yl]methyl]acetamide (PubChem CID 10251711) has the molecular formula C19H26FN5O5 and a molecular weight of 423.45 g/mol. Its IUPAC name is 2-amino-N-[[(5S)-3-[3-fluoro-4-[4-(2-methoxyacetyl)piperazin-1-yl]phenyl]-2-oxo-1,3-oxazolidin-5-yl]methyl]acetamide.
